On the 11th of November, Thursday, the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) staged a protest against the ruling Telangana Rashtra Samithi (TRS) Government.

Mr. Bandi Sanjay Kumar, the President of the BJP of Telangana unit and BJP cadres staged a protest, demanding the TRS Government to buy paddy from farmers.

In regard to this, the BJP organised several rallies across the State with the participation of BJP cadres in big numbers. Interacting with district party presidents, in charges and heads of various morchas at the state party headquarters, Mr. Bandi Sanjay Kumar asked Mr. K. Chandrashekar Rao, the Chief Minister of Telangana, why they are not procuring paddy produced by the farmers of Telangana.

He said, what is the hesitation of the TRS Government in buying paddy, when the Central Government assured to acquire 60 lakh metric tonnes. In addition, the BJP led Central Government assured Rs. 1,960 as Minimum Support Price (MSP) for paddy apart from bearing the expenses of gunny bags, transport and godown storage charges among other expenses.

Mr. Bandi Sanjay Kumar highlighted the difficulties of farmers due to paddy delivery delays. He expressed outrage that the TRS blamed the Centre for the procurement issue, when the State Government itself is not buying the paddy produced by the farmers of Telangana.

Therefore, in order to put pressure on the KCR Government, the BJP conducted rallies at district collector offices in Telangana.

The rallies and demonstrations by the BJP are underway in various regions of Telangana.
